The Red Sox Foundation and Massachusetts General Hospital Home Base Program is honored to announce iconic entertainer Reba will headline the third annual Mission Gratitude benefit concert at Boston's Symphony Hall, Monday, November 9th, 2015 at 7PM.Reba

The Home Base Program is the first and largest private-sector program in America solely focused on healing the Invisible Wounds of War - including post-traumatic stress and traumatic brain injury - for Service Members, Post-9/11 Veterans and Military Families. Their Mission Gratitude benefit is the largest concert event in New England to honor the deserving men and women of the Armed Forces. The funds raised from Mission Gratitude help Home Base as they continue to heal the Invisible Wounds of War on a local, regional and national level through clinical care, wellness-based programs, fitness, education and research.

"One in three returning Veterans suffers from post-traumatic stress or a traumatic brain injury. By working together, we can give them the healthy future they deserve," said Brigadier General (Ret.) Jack Hammond, Executive Director of the Home Base Program. "We are extremely grateful to the sponsors and donors to this event, and we are honored to have the incomparable Reba headline Mission Gratitude."

The event is scheduled just two days before Veterans Day, and will feature Reba performing hits from her illustrious career as well as selections from her latest offering LOVE SOMEBODY. The Country Music Hall of Fame member and Grammy Award winner released her 27th studio album on Nash Icon Records in April, since debuting two singles "Going Out Like That" and "Until They Don't Love You."

Mission Gratitude is chaired by Jack Connors, Jr. (Chairman Emertius of Hill Hollida and Partners HealthCare; David Ginsberg (Vice Chairman, Fenway Sports Group); Peter Slavin, MS (President, Mass General Hospital); and Tom Werner (Chairman, Boston Red Sox and Red Sox Foundation).
